Abstract

The results of lithofacies studies and paleogeographic reconstructions of the Late DevonianEarly Visean stage and stratigraphic evolution of the Primorskaya zone of uplifts in the south of Precaspian Basin are presented. The complex geological structure of the region is mainly due to the influence of tectonic, volcanic and denudation processes on sedimentation. The spatial distribution of carbonate accumulations in the Primorskaya zone of the Precaspian Basin is determined by the different duration of sedimentation stages and the block structure of the basement. The results of the deep wells drilled in the recent years have made it possible to refine the internal geological structure, justification of new exploration objects in the Late Devonian strata and reevaluate the oil and gas potential and petroleum resources in the south of the Precaspian depression. After recent exploration works, the geological model for the onshore prospective structure traps has been improved, additionally prospective exploration objects have been predicted in the shelf of the Caspian Sea. The most of potential petroleum resources of the Primorskaya zone is the resources of the new offshore exploration objects in Caspian Sea. Non-structural traps can accumulate gigantic hydrocarbon volumes. This is a new highly prospective hydrocarbon exploration direction in the Precaspian Basin
